| /** |
| * 8088flex TMV video decoder |
| * @file |
| * @author Daniel Verkamp |
| * @sa http://www.oldskool.org/pc/8088_Corruption |
| */ |
| |
| #include "avcodec.h" |
| |
| #include "cga_data.h" |
| |
| typedef struct TMVContext { |
| AVFrame pic; |
| } TMVContext; |
| |
| static av_cold int tmv_decode_init(AVCodecContext *avctx) |
| { |
| TMVContext *tmv = avctx->priv_data; |
| |
| avcodec_get_frame_defaults(&tmv->pic); |
| return 0; |
| } |
| |
| static int tmv_decode_frame(AVCodecContext *avctx, void *data, |
| int *data_size, AVPacket *avpkt) |
| { |
| TMVContext *tmv = avctx->priv_data; |
| const uint8_t *src = avpkt->data; |
| uint8_t *dst; |
| unsigned char_cols = avctx->width >> 3; |
| unsigned char_rows = avctx->height >> 3; |
| unsigned x, y, fg, bg, c; |
| |
| if (tmv->pic.data[0]) |
| avctx->release_buffer(avctx, &tmv->pic); |
| |
| if (avctx->get_buffer(avctx, &tmv->pic) < 0) { |
| av_log(avctx, AV_LOG_ERROR, "get_buffer() failed\n"); |
| return -1; |
| } |
| |
| if (avpkt->size < 2*char_rows*char_cols) { |
| av_log(avctx, AV_LOG_ERROR, |
| "Input buffer too small, truncated sample?\n"); |
| *data_size = 0; |
| return -1; |
| } |
| |
| tmv->pic.pict_type = AV_PICTURE_TYPE_I; |
| tmv->pic.key_frame = 1; |
| dst = tmv->pic.data[0]; |
| |
| tmv->pic.palette_has_changed = 1; |
| memcpy(tmv->pic.data[1], ff_cga_palette, 16 * 4); |
| |
| for (y = 0; y < char_rows; y++) { |
| for (x = 0; x < char_cols; x++) { |
| c = *src++; |
| bg = *src >> 4; |
| fg = *src++ & 0xF; |
| ff_draw_pc_font(dst + x * 8, tmv->pic.linesize[0], |
| ff_cga_font, 8, c, fg, bg); |
| } |
| dst += tmv->pic.linesize[0] * 8; |
| } |
| |
| *data_size = sizeof(AVFrame); |
| *(AVFrame *)data = tmv->pic; |
| return avpkt->size; |
| } |
| |
| static av_cold int tmv_decode_close(AVCodecContext *avctx) |
| { |
| TMVContext *tmv = avctx->priv_data; |
| |
| if (tmv->pic.data[0]) |
| avctx->release_buffer(avctx, &tmv->pic); |
| |
| return 0; |
| } |
| |
| AVCodec ff_tmv_decoder = { |
| .name = "tmv", |
| .type = AVMEDIA_TYPE_VIDEO, |
| .id = CODEC_ID_TMV, |
| .priv_data_size = sizeof(TMVContext), |
| .init = tmv_decode_init, |
| .close = tmv_decode_close, |
| .decode = tmv_decode_frame, |
| .capabilities = CODEC_CAP_DR1, |
| .long_name = NULL_IF_CONFIG_SMALL("8088flex TMV"), |
| }; |
